集团其他站点      
  首页        联系我们

软件行业的CMM是指什么?


关键字:CMM,CMM是什么,软件CMM,CMM等级

CMM基本概念:CMM由低至高共分为5个级别:初始级、可重复级、定义级、管理级和优化级CMMI(Capability Maturity Model Integration,能力成熟度模型集成)将各种能力成熟度模型,即:Software CMM、Systems Eng-CMM、People CMM和Acquisition CMM,整合到同一架构中去,由此建立起包括软件工程、系统工程和软件采购等在内的诸模型的集成,以解决除软件开发以外的软件系统工程和软件采购工作中的迫切需求。

背景介绍: CMM是“软件能力成熟度模型”的英文简写,该模型由美国卡内基-梅隆大学的软件工程研究所(简称SEI)受美国国防部委托,于1991年研究制定,初始的主要目的是为了评价美国国防部的软件合同承包组织的能力,后因为在软件企业应用CMM模型实施过程改进取得较大的成功,所以在全世界范围内被广泛使用,SEI同时建立了主任评估师评估制度,CMM的评估方法为CBA-IPI。

引进CMM的主要意义:
一.对软件公司
1.提高软件公司软件开发的管理能力,因为CMM可提供软件公司自我评估的方法和自我提高的手段。
2.提高软件生产率。
3.提高软件质量。
4.提高软件公司的国内和国际竞争力。
二.对软件项目发包单位和软件用户提供了对软件开发商开发管理水平的评估手段,有助于软件开发项目的风险识别。我国CMM工作的开展相对滞后,全面正式开展CMM评估工作还需一定时间,但只是迟早的问题。业内有识之士呼吁我国应结合国情,及早开展CMM有关工作。我公司作为西安地区软件业龙头企业,应学习、消化和借鉴CMM有关管理思想和方法等先进知识,结合公司ISO9000质量管理等具体工作,不断改进和完善我公司的管理体系,推动我公司各项工作全面发展,并为我公司早日正式开展CMM评估工作打下良好的基础。